Output bdddd62e136233f5d8c541288f260259d2350f83b8e4425cfa81b3d7dbd87a3d:0

value
90420857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d86cc2356c5d093835cf0312b2d807e58ad454 OP_EQUAL
address
399mvYUJ9nQQy8tbPbYmhnFFQWSDKDdU4u
transaction
bdddd62e136233f5d8c541288f260259d2350f83b8e4425cfa81b3d7dbd87a3d
confirmations
302761
spent
true